SUMMARY

The Technical Trainer is responsible for building, delivering, and continuously improving the training and development program that equips manufacturing employees to succeed — from their first day of onboarding through the full arc of their career at Firefly.

This role is both a teacher and a program builder. As a teacher, the Technical Trainer delivers engaging, hands-on instruction that helps employees navigate company and employee systems, understand manufacturing processes and documentation, and develop the technical skills needed to support production. As a program builder, this role designs a structured onboarding and development pathway that ramps new hires quickly, reinforces skills over time, and measures whether the training is actually working.

The trainer will learn Firefly's full composites manufacturing lifecycle - working closely with technicians, engineers, Quality, and other subject-matter experts - and translate that knowledge into a scalable, technology-enabled curriculum. A key part of this role is tracking training effectiveness and surfacing trends back to the engineering and operations teams to help shape processes that enable faster, more reliable onboarding.

R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Facilitate engaging instructor‑led classroom, small‑group, and hands‑on technical training, adapting delivery to different experience levels and learning styles.
  • Teach employees to navigate company and employee systems (timekeeping, learning/training, manufacturing documentation) and to access work instructions, drawings, specifications, and production records.
  • Teach proper documentation, traceability, and manufacturing process requirements, including composites instruction spanning material handling, tool prep, layup, bonding, vacuum bagging, curing, autoclave operations, trimming, finishing, and inspection.
  • Design and own a structured onboarding program that equips technicians and new hires from day one, with clear milestones, competencies, and qualification checkpoints.
  • Build career‑long development pathways that reinforce, advance, and re‑qualify skills well beyond initial onboarding.
  • Develop lesson plans, presentations, demonstrations, job aids, exercises, knowledge checks, and full curricula grounded in adult‑learning and instructional‑design principles.
  • Use technology and modern content tools (LMS, video, interactive e‑learning, digital job aids) to create impactful, scalable, and repeatable courses.
  • Define and track training‑effectiveness metrics (time‑to‑productivity, competency attainment, qualification pass rates, on‑floor performance) and analyze the data to identify trends and gaps.
